Once I shot some high pressure solvent through a gas tube when I was changing out the block and had it off. I sprayed through it onto a sheet of white printer paper and after the solvent evaporated, the sheet was as clean as before I did it. A little puckered, but no sign of debris and it was a strong HFC solvent. Its a matter of personal preference and a confidence builder. If you seriously believe it will improve your shooting, it probably will.
